SSP Traffic Rural Kmr warns Parents Providing Vehicles to Teenagers without Licenses

Launches massive Crack Down against overloading of school buses

Budgam: Senior superintendent of police (SSP) Traffic Rural Kashmir Ravindr Pal Singh, has issued a stern warning against parents who provide bikes and cars to their teenage children without driving licenses.

Speaking during an inspection of a massive drive against traffic violators in Magam area of central Kashmir’s Budgam district, SSP traffic rural said that strict action will be taken against such parents and the violators who provide Vehicles to their teenager childrens.

The officer highlighted the risks associated with underage driving and the menace of stunts performed in public places by teenagers.

Over the issue of overloading in School buses He mentioned that the traffic department has been receiving numerous complaints about school buses overloading, which led to a special drive in the Magam area targeting these violators.

During the drive, more than 70 e-challans were issued, and several vehicles, including two-wheelers, were seized for various traffic violations.

Ssp traffic Said that besides seizing the vehicles, strict action will be taken against the stunt bikers, moreover their parents will be also put behind bars.

SSP Traffic urged the general public to adopt a traffic-friendly behavior and cooperate with the authorities in ensuring road safety.(KNS)
